Look at the payload system below! The solid insulator sphere (radius a = 9 cm) is in the center of the hollow conductor sphere (inner radius b = 15 cm and outer radius c = 20 cm). The insulating ball is given a positive charge of 10 C and the conductor ball is given a negative charge of -5C a. Calculate the electric field r = 5 cm, r = 12 cm, r = 18 cm and r = 15 cm, r is calculated and the center of the sphere b. Calculate the charge on the inner surface of the conducting sphere and on the outer surface of the conducting sphere
